BSOD on XP Install for dual boot?

I've created an NTFS partition for XP with the disk manager in Windows 7, but when I boot from my XP CD after it goes through some processes I get a blue screen of death and can't even get to the beginning of the installation. Any ideas on something I might be doing wrong?
